
Buying travel insurance at the right time and choosing adequate coverage are important before travelling abroad. The policy should be purchased before departure, as buying it after leaving the country can make the coverage invalid. For longer trips, frequent travellers and elderly people visiting family abroad, a higher sum insured may be more suitable. Meet Kapadia, Business Head, Policybazaar, explains why travellers should also consider pre-existing disease coverage where required. Policies are available through insurers, travel agents, airlines and online travel platforms, but comparing coverage, exclusions and limits is important. The right policy duration should match the entire trip, while the sum insured should reflect the destination and potential medical costs.
